
On Thursday, the Eiffel Tower will turn off its lights for five minutes. Why? To draw attention and support for a campaign to help conserve energy. The campaign is called "Five Minutes of Respite for the Planet" and is coinciding with the gathering of world experts in Paris who are going over a report on global warming. Already, the Eiffel Tower has changed its lighting system to reduce energy consumption by 30 percent, according to the SETE agency that manages it. You can read the article
